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Amenities

Layton (Lancs) is a rather modest station, reflecting the quiet and tranquil nature of its surroundings. It does not boast a ticket office or ticket machines, so purchasing and collecting tickets prior to arriving at the station is essential. Nonetheless, there's an emphasis on accessibility, as there are step-free accesses via ramps onto both platforms. However, moving between platforms requires navigating a series of steps.

Despite the absence of staffed help, the station responds to the needs of all travelers by enabling assistance through conductors on trains. CCTV cameras are installed for added security, and while there's no formal waiting room, a seating area is available. Unfortunately, refreshment facilities, ATMs, and bicycles storage are not available, reminding travelers to plan accordingly before arrival.

Connectivity and Travel Options

Transportation from Layton (Lancs) extends beyond rail services, providing essential links to various modes of travel. Bus services are conveniently located nearby on Benson Road, ensuring a seamless transition from train to local destinations. Although there's no on-site bicycle hire, helpful taxi services can be arranged via Northern Railway's Cab4You, making onward journeys effortless for travelers.

Facilities and Services

Though lacking a traditional ticket office, Heighington Station allows passengers to purchase and collect tickets via accessible machines situated on Platform 1. For those with visual or auditory impairments, an induction loop is available. While there aren't amenities like cafes, shops, or waiting rooms, the station is equipped with customer help points and helpful information screens to keep you updated on departure times. For any assistance required, travelers can rest easy knowing there’s a helpline available at 08002006060.

Accessibility at Heighington

Heighington Station is categorized as a Category B station, meaning that step-free access is possible in some regions of the station. There is level access to the platforms via a level crossing, ensuring that individuals with mobility impairments or those using wheelchairs can navigate with relative ease. However, there are no accessible toilets or waiting room facilities, so it's wise to plan accordingly.

Onward Travel Options

Should your journey take you further afield, rest assured that Heighington provides several onward travel options. There is a bus stop conveniently located near the station, serviced by Busline at 0871 200 2233. For those seeking a more direct route, taxi services can be arranged through Northern Rail's Cab4You service. During periods of rail replacement, passengers will find the pick-up/drop-off point at the lay-by near the level crossing.
